In Australia, a full time Museum Assistant generally earns $1,160 per week ($60,320 annual salary) before tax. This is a median figure for full-time employees and should be considered a guide only. As you gain more experience you can expect a potentially higher salary than people who are new to the industry.

The number of people working as a Museum Assistant has decreased in recent years. There are currently 1,200 people employed in this role in Australia compared to 1,500 five years ago. Museum Assistants may find work across all regions of Australia, particularly in larger towns and cities where museums are located.

Source: Australian Government Labour Market Insights

To become a Museum Assistant, consider enrolling in a Certificate III in Library and Information Services. This course will prepare you to work in museums, libraries, art galleries and cultural service organisations. You’ll develop skills in customer service and records management and learn to use digital technologies such as loan management software and cataloguing systems.
